Copenhagen might organise 2010 referendum on abolishing opt-outS if Lisbon treaty enters into force this year

Brussels, 17/03/2009 (Agence Europe) - The Danish government still envisages getting rid of the four “opt-outs” negotiated before the ratification of the Maastricht Treaty in 1992 (euro, defence, justice and home affairs, citizenship) and may organise a single referendum on the four subjects in 2010 on the condition that the Lisbon Treaty enters into force before the end of the year.
